Spare The Air Alert


A Winter Spare the Air Alert has been issued for Friday, December 13th, in the Bay Area.

Wood burning is banned both indoors and outdoors on Friday, for the full 24 hours.

Air quality in the Bay Area is forecast to be unhealthy. It is illegal for Bay Area residents to burn wood or other solid fuels in fireplaces, wood stoves and inserts, pellet stoves, outdoor fire-pits, or other wood-burning devices.  This wood-burning ban will be in effect for Alameda, Contra Costa, Marin, Napa, San Francisco, San Mateo, Santa Clara, southern Sonoma and southwestern Solano Counties. (Visit www.sparetheair.org/Stay-Informed/Todays-Air-Quality/Reporting-Zones.aspx to see if your city is located within the Air District.)

Winter air pollution is mainly caused by particulates or soot pollution from wood smoke. Smoke from wood-burning fires is linked to illnesses such as asthma, bronchitis and lung disease, and is especially harmful for children and the elderly.

Winter Wonderettes


photo (18)One of the things I love most about my job is the importance I get to place on community involvement. Whether it's donations to local schools, or helping out various non profit groups, it's a pleasure for me to make us not just a store, but a part of the community.  So when the Coastal Repertory Theatre told us about their upcoming play that takes place in a hardware store, I knew we had to be part of it.

If you think their hardware store set looks rather realistic, that's because it is!  The pegboard and shelves are on loan from our store, along with many of the props.  When it came time to light up the stage with over 1,000 Christmas lights, we got them their special vintage-style bulb strings to make the scene feel like a 1968 hardware store!

They invited us to see the Saturday show, and after seeing the production I can honestly say, if you don't go and see the Winter Wonderettes it truly is your loss.  My friends and I haven't laughed so hard or had such a good time dancing in our seats in I don't know how long. The play was a top notch production that had us giggling nonstop.

Winter Wonderettes is running from November 22 - December 21.  Please don't miss out on this enjoyable, fun for the whole family, Christmas-themed production!
